Among the following mixtures, dipole-dipole as the major interaction, is present in

A
benzene and ethanol
B
acetonitrile and acetone
C
KCl and water
D
benzene and carbon tetrachloride

Share this question

For Instagram sharing, use “Apps” on mobile or copy the link.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ts
The correct answer is:
B

Dipole-dipole interactions occur among the polar molecules. Polar molecules have permanent dipole. The positive pole of one molecule is thus attracted by the negative pole of the other molecule. The magnitude of dipole-dipole forces in different polar molecules is predicted on the basis of the polarity of the molecules, which in turn depends upon the electronegativities of the atoms present in the molecule and the geometry of the molecule (in case of polyatomic molecules, containing more than two atoms in a molecule).
